How to Measure Your Ring Size
Method 1: Using a Ring Sizer
- Visit a local jewelry store for professional sizing
- Use a plastic ring sizer tool (most accurate method)
- Try different sizes until you find the perfect fit
Method 2: Measuring an Existing Ring
- Take a ring that fits the intended finger perfectly
- Measure the inside diameter in millimeters
- Use our size chart below to find your size
Method 3: String or Paper Method
- Wrap a piece of string or paper around your finger
- Mark where the string/paper overlaps
- Measure the length in millimeters
- Divide by 3.14 to get the diameter

Important Tips
- Measure your finger at the end of the day when it's largest
- Consider the width of the ring - wider rings need larger sizes
- Account for knuckle size - the ring needs to fit over your knuckle
- Temperature affects finger size - avoid measuring when very hot or cold
Between Sizes?
If you're between sizes, consider:
- Choose the larger size for wider rings
- Choose the smaller size for narrow rings
- Consider the season - fingers are larger in summer
